A multi-year technology modernization program is approaching its formal closure. While all component projects have delivered their outputs, the program steering committee is concerned about the operational readiness of the business units to sustain the new systems. The program manager has also identified several outstanding vendor invoices. What action should the program manager prioritize to ensure the program closes successfully within its defined boundaries?
Archive all program documentation in the organization's knowledge repository immediately.
Escalate the pending vendor invoices to the finance department for immediate processing.
Conduct a final lessons learned workshop with all key stakeholders.
Finalize and execute the benefits sustainment plan with operational owners.
The correct action is to finalize and execute the benefits sustainment plan with operational owners. This directly addresses the steering committee's strategic concern about long-term value and operational readiness, which is crucial for a successful transition and formal closure. While processing invoices, archiving documents, and conducting a lessons learned workshop are all necessary closure activities, they are secondary to ensuring the program's primary benefits are sustained post-closure.
